Which Industries Hire the Most Instructional Design Graduates?
Instructional design graduates consistently find the most opportunities in sectors where the need to develop effective learning experiences is critical to organizational goals. Analysis of employment distribution data from the U.S. Bureau of Labor Statistics and industry studies from 2024 reveals that the majority of instructional design professionals are employed by organizations balancing traditional roles with emerging digital learning modalities. Employment demand fluctuates with economic changes and geographic factors, but some industries remain stable due to ongoing training needs and regulatory requirements. Below are key industries that regularly recruit large numbers of instructional design graduates.
- Education sector: This remains the largest employer, encompassing K-12 schools, universities, and e-learning companies. Instructional designers in this sector focus on creating curriculum materials and integrating technology to support remote and hybrid learning environments. The sector's commitment to digital transformation and lifelong learning provides sustained demand, particularly as institutions adapt to evolving student needs.
- Corporate training: Large businesses across technology, finance, healthcare, and retail invest heavily in employee development programs. Instructional designers here create compliance modules, leadership training, and skills development courses. These roles often require customizing content for diverse employee populations, making corporate training an attractive option for graduates who want to work on varied and measurable performance outcomes.
- Healthcare industry: Hospitals, pharmaceutical firms, and medical organizations rely on instructional designers to deliver training that meets stringent regulatory standards. With rapid introduction of new technologies and protocols in healthcare, instructional design supports continuous education critical to patient safety and staff competency. This sector's growth ties closely to advancements in medical practice and health IT systems.
- Government agencies: Federal, state, and local agencies consistently employ instructional design graduates to develop training for public safety, administration, and defense sectors. These positions emphasize compliance and procedural learning, with a growing focus on adaptable e-learning formats that support remote workforce needs.
- Nonprofit and consulting firms: Emerging opportunities exist within nonprofits and specialized consulting services, particularly for projects focused on community education and professional development initiatives. These roles tend to require instructional designers who can tailor content to noncommercial audiences and diverse stakeholder groups, often demanding creativity and flexibility.
Instructional design graduate job demand by sector continues to reflect the need for specialized skills applicable across these domains, each offering unique challenges and long-term prospects. For example, a graduate working with a hospital system might help design training to ensure new software compliance-this requires both subject matter expertise and instructional finesse. Similarly, those focusing on corporate training may regularly update interactive modules to keep pace with changing regulations and market dynamics.

Which Industries Offer the Highest Salaries for Instructional Design Graduates?
Salary disparities among industries employing instructional design graduates largely reflect variations in budget size, regulatory complexity, and the strategic value placed on workforce development. Sectors like technology and finance often invest heavily in training due to rapid innovation cycles and compliance demands, boosting salary potential. In contrast, education and nonprofit institutions may prioritize stability and mission over compensation, resulting in more modest pay. Real-world hiring decisions also weigh factors such as required domain expertise and the technical complexity of e-learning products. Below are industries that typically offer the highest paying opportunities for instructional design graduates.
- Technology Sector:The technology industry commands top salaries for instructional design professionals, with median wages near $90,000 as reported by the U.S. Bureau of Labor Statistics. Roles often involve developing adaptive learning platforms, software training modules, and virtual reality applications, requiring advanced technical proficiency and rapid content iteration. Companies in this field value instructional designers who combine creativity with strong IT skills to keep pace with evolving software and hardware landscapes.
- Financial Services and Insurance:Highly regulated environments push training complexity and volume, driving salaries above average, with entry-level positions starting around $75,000 and median pay near $85,000. Instructional designers here focus on compliance training, risk management education, and certification programs. The need for accuracy, auditability, and frequent updates makes these roles critical to organizational success, reflecting in higher compensation.
- Healthcare Industry:Demand for instructional designers with healthcare domain knowledge has increased alongside the rise in digital health technologies and continuous professional development for clinical staff. Median salaries often exceed $80,000 due to the specialized nature of content and the importance of delivering clear, evidence-based training. Expertise in medical terminology and regulatory standards can notably enhance earning potential.

Which Skills Are Most In Demand Across Instructional Design Industries?
The most valuable career skills for instructional design graduates tend to remain consistent across industries because they address fundamental employer needs for adaptability, technical competence, and effective communication. Regardless of sector, companies seek professionals who can translate subject knowledge into engaging learning experiences while supporting organizational goals. For example, in healthcare, understanding compliance through instructional models is as critical as mastering software that delivers training efficiently. Identifying these universally sought-after abilities provides clarity for students aiming to enter diverse fields such as corporate training, government, or education. Below are key skills highlighted by recent workforce data reflecting top skills required in instructional design jobs.
- Technical Authoring Tools: Proficiency in software like Articulate Storyline, Adobe Captivate, and Camtasia remains foundational. Employers value candidates who can quickly develop interactive courses that meet evolving learner needs. Gaining hands-on experience with these tools during program work or internships bolsters job readiness and long-term adaptability.
- Instructional Design Methodologies: Familiarity with models such as ADDIE, SAM, and Agile Learning Design is essential. These frameworks guide the creation of learner-centered content that improves engagement and retention, a priority across healthcare, corporate, and government sectors focused on skill certification and compliance.
- Learning Management Systems (LMS): Mastery of platforms like Moodle, Blackboard, and Canvas facilitates effective delivery and management of digital training programs. This skill supports flexible deployment and reporting crucial to scalable workforce training initiatives in multiple industries.
- Communication and Collaboration: Strong interpersonal skills are critical as instructional designers regularly coordinate with subject matter experts and stakeholders. Developing these through project-based teamwork during courses or internships enhances employability and supports cross-functional workflow efficiency.
- Analytical Evaluation: The ability to assess learning effectiveness through data and feedback is increasingly valued. Skills in measurement and analytics enable designers to demonstrate return on investment, a growing requirement as organizations emphasize performance metrics.
- Multimedia Development: Competency in video editing, animation, and graphic design helps create immersive learning experiences. This expertise increasingly distinguishes candidates in industries pushing interactive content, reflecting broader technology trends.
- Emerging Technologies: Experience with virtual reality (VR), augmented reality (AR), and AI-driven adaptive learning systems signals preparedness for future instructional design demands. Early engagement with these technologies can set graduates apart in competitive job markets.
According to the U.S. Bureau of Labor Statistics and the eLearning Guild, more than 75% of employers emphasize combined technical and transferable skills when seeking candidates for instructional design roles, underscoring the importance of a balanced skill set across varying industry requirements. How Do Career Paths Differ Across Industries for Instructional Design Graduates?
Selecting an industry to launch an instructional design career influences growth as much as the degree itself. Different sectors prioritize diverse skills, experiences, and career trajectories, meaning what excels in one environment may offer limited advancement in another. For instance, corporate roles may favor rapid managerial ascent through digital learning expertise, while academia often rewards deep specialization but slower promotion. Understanding these nuances helps graduates align their ambitions with realistic pathways and identify where their strengths will be most valued. Below are key ways career paths for instructional design graduates diverge across industries.
- Advancement Velocity: Corporate environments tend to offer faster upward movement, with nearly half of instructional designers reaching director-level positions within seven years, driven by a competitive market and digital transformation demands. In contrast, government roles often provide steadier but slower promotions tied to civil service structures, averaging an 18% promotion rate over five years.
- Skill Demand Focus: Healthcare is a growing sector emphasizing compliance and clinical knowledge integration, rewarding those who combine instructional strategy with healthcare expertise. Academia prioritizes pedagogical mastery and subject matter expertise, often requiring patience in navigating institutional hierarchies.
- Role Specialization: Higher education often offers niche roles supporting faculty or educational technology, which may limit broad leadership opportunities but enhance curriculum influence. Corporate roles are broader, often encompassing analytics, change management, and e-learning development that can lead to diverse leadership paths.
- Salary Growth Patterns: Early-career salaries in healthcare instructional design can increase up to 15% annually, outpacing other industries, but moving into executive roles may demand additional certifications. Corporate salaries reflect market competition favoring tech-savvy instructional designers, while government pay scales are fixed yet predictable.
- Workplace Structure: Government jobs usually feature formal pay scales and promotion criteria embedded in civil service systems, offering stability but limited flexibility. Corporate and healthcare sectors often provide dynamic and evolving environments that reward innovation and adaptability.
- Cross-Disciplinary Opportunities: Healthcare encourages collaboration across clinical and instructional teams, opening pathways to hybrid roles. Corporate sectors may integrate instructional design within broader talent development functions, expanding scope and influence.
- Job Security and Stability: Academia often provides stable employment through institutional funding cycles despite slower advancement, attracting those valuing long-term security over rapid promotion. Conversely, corporate and healthcare industries may carry higher volatility tied to market shifts but offer quicker growth potential.

Other Things You Should Know About Instructional Design
The rapid evolution of technology in sectors like healthcare and corporate training significantly increases the complexity and frequency of updates instructional designers must handle. Graduates entering these fields should anticipate a workload that demands continuous learning and agile design processes, as content and tools quickly become outdated. Prioritizing industries with slower technology cycles may offer a more manageable workload but often at the cost of lower salary growth and innovation exposure.
Highly regulated industries such as healthcare and finance require instructional designers to navigate strict compliance standards, which can limit creative flexibility but ensure stable demand and funding for training programs. Conversely, less regulated sectors like tech startups may offer more creative freedom and faster project cycles but can be riskier due to funding variability and less structured support. Graduates must weigh priority on innovation versus job security and regulatory familiarity when choosing their focus.
Industries like government and defense often prioritize candidates with specialized certifications and demonstrable experience, creating higher barriers to entry for recent graduates. In contrast, sectors such as education and nonprofit may emphasize foundational instructional design skills and offer more entry-level opportunities. Graduates should align their credentialing efforts with their target industry's hiring practices or consider gaining experience through internships to improve employability.
Instructional designers targeting sectors with cyclical budgets or rapidly changing priorities, like media or event-based industries, face higher risks of job instability and shifting project focus. Prioritizing industries with steady investment in workforce development, such as healthcare or large educational institutions, tends to yield more predictable career progression. Graduates focused on long-term career sustainability should emphasize sectors with consistent mandates for professional development despite economic fluctuations.
